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Не отправляются электронные товары после оплаты


Recommended Posts

Народ, привет!

 

Хочу задать вопрос тем, кто сталкивался с проблемой отправки электронных товаров после оплаты. Т.е. они просто-напросто не отправляются, а так же отсутствуют в личном кабинете покупателя как приобретённые.

 

 Думал, что проблема в конкретном модуле оплаты (Onpay), но подключив и тестируя другую систему приёма оплаты (Nextpay) ситуация оказалось аналогичной - деньги в кабинете платёжной системы приходят, но Опенкарт на это никак не реагирует. 

Отправляет только лишь письмо о том, что:

 

"Для просмотра Вашего заказа перейдите по ссылке:

http://мойсайт/index.php?route=account/order/info&order_id=7

После подтверждения оплаты, чтобы скачать товар, щелкните:

http://мойсайт/index.php?route=account/download"

 

 

А об оплате ничего будто-бы не знает и не реагирует...

Заранее благодарен всем откликнувшимся по данному вопросу...

Спасибо!

Надіслати
Поділитися на інших сайтах


Статус таких заказов  должен быть "Завершено",тогда в личном кабинете появится сам файл.

Надіслати
Поділитися на інших сайтах

Статус таких заказов  должен быть "Завершено",тогда в личном кабинете появится сам файл.

В настройках обоих модулей указан статус "Сделка завершена"... Это ведь то же самое..?

Надіслати
Поділитися на інших сайтах


ну так если он не меняется на него после оплаты

значит неправильно настроены уведомления на сайт

 

например блокирование уведомлений происходит если в настройках магазина включен режим технического обслуживания

Надіслати
Поділитися на інших сайтах

ну так если он не меняется на него после оплаты

значит неправильно настроены уведомления на сайт

 

например блокирование уведомлений происходит если в настройках магазина включен режим технического обслуживания

 

Нет, сайт открыт, а по поводу других уведомлений не подскажете ли где можно убедиться?

Надіслати
Поділитися на інших сайтах


"Электронные товары" никогда никуда не отправлялись.

При правильно настроенной цепочке статусов они после оплаты становятся доступны для скачивания в личном кабинете в магазине.

Надіслати
Поділитися на інших сайтах

"Электронные товары" никогда никуда не отправлялись.

При правильно настроенной цепочке статусов они после оплаты становятся доступны для скачивания в личном кабинете в магазине.

Не подскажете-ли, что значит "При правильно настроенной цепочке статусов.."? 

И разве не должен магазин отправлять покупателю письмо после оплаты...?

 

Спасибо!

Надіслати
Поділитися на інших сайтах


"Электронные товары" никогда никуда не отправлялись.

 

 

Стояло напротив "Необходима доставка:" - Да. Перевёл на "Нет", но картина та же... Какой-то полтергейст...

Надіслати
Поділитися на інших сайтах


админка - система - настройки :: магазин - опции

>> Статус готового заказа:

>> Статус заказа, который клиент должен получить для доступа к скачиваемому товару или подарочному сертификату.

админка - дополнения - оплата :: модуль оплаты

>> @Order Status:@ (или что там у вас в конкретном модуле) - такой же, как выше.

После оплаты (если не было ошибок/сбоев) заказу присваивается правильный статус и в кабинете появляется возможность скачать электронный товар.

- - -

>> И разве не должен магазин отправлять покупателю письмо после оплаты...?

отправляется только уведомление о создании заказа. с этим у вас порядок:

>> Отправляет только лишь письмо о том, что:...

проверьте на бесплатном товаре и free_checkout.

Надіслати
Поділитися на інших сайтах

Т.е. как я понял, важно, чтобы статусы в обоих настройках были одинаковые... Да, так и есть.. В обоих стоит "Сделка завершена". Так же пробовал в обоих местах (настройке опций магазина и модуля оплаты) менять на "Доставлено", но то же самое... В личном кабинете загрузок так и не появляется... 

 

Ошибок или сбоев при оплате никаких не происходит.

 

На бесплатном товаре проверить не получается, т.к. платёжная система иначе не принимает....

 

Вообще, не может ли влиять "на это" какой-нибудь из модулей... ? (Хотя "ничего такого" вроде не установлено...)

Змінено користувачем afwollis
overquote deleted
Надіслати
Поділитися на інших сайтах


>> На бесплатном товаре проверить не получается, т.к. платёжная система иначе не принимает....

читайте полностью, а не только часть предложений:

>> проверьте на бесплатном товаре и free_checkout.

есть такой метод оплаты

- - -

файлы-то, сами, привязаны к товарам? (товар : вкладка связи)

Надіслати
Поділитися на інших сайтах

Да, к

 

>> На бесплатном товаре проверить не получается, т.к. платёжная система иначе не принимает....

читайте полностью, а не только часть предложений:
>> проверьте на бесплатном товаре и free_checkout.

есть такой метод оплаты

- - -

файлы-то, сами, привязаны к товарам? (товар : вкладка связи)

 

Да, конечно, файлы привязаны (при помощи мода "лёгкая загрузка"), только free_checkout пока не нахожу, чтобы воспользоваться...

Надіслати
Поділитися на інших сайтах


>> при помощи мода "лёгкая загрузка"

это что?

>> только free_checkout пока не нахожу, чтобы воспользоваться...

админка - дополнения - оплата :: Бесплатный заказ

http://demo.myopencart.ru/admin/index.php?route=extension/payment&token=3b6cc20d74398226ff89aba032ce6e47

demo : demo

Надіслати
Поділитися на інших сайтах

Судя по ...

 

отправки электронных товаров после оплаты

 

 

... У  вас какой-то модуль стоит, который "должен" отправлять? Или вы всё делаете средствами функционала opencart?

 

Так там нету "отправки"

Если "модуль", то мы можем телепатировать сколько угодно, почему он глючит, не зная его

Надіслати
Поділитися на інших сайтах

>> при помощи мода "лёгкая загрузка"

это что?

>> только free_checkout пока не нахожу, чтобы воспользоваться...

админка - дополнения - оплата :: Бесплатный заказ

http://demo.myopencart.ru/admin/index.php?route=extension/payment&token=3b6cc20d74398226ff89aba032ce6e47

demo : demo

Это мод "easy upload" для для добавления в базу информации о файлах после их (массовой) загрузки по ФТП (Исправно добавляются и ассоциируются при автозаполнении поля "связи")

 

Попробовал оформить заказ товара бесплатно при помощи активации метода free_checkout, переводит на страницу, где:

 

 
Ваш заказ сформирован!
 
Ваш заказ успешно создан!
 
Вы можете просматривать историю заказов в Личном кабинете, открыв Историю заказов.
Если Ваша покупка связана со скачиваемым файлом, вы можете перейти на страницу файлов для скачивания для их просмотра.
 
 
Все вопросы направляйте нам.
 

Спасибо за покупки в нашем интернет-магазине!

 

 и письмо

 

Благодарим за интерес к товарам Каталог аудио-фонов для вашей медиапродукции. Ваш заказ получен и поступит в обработку после подтверждения оплаты.

Для просмотра Вашего заказа перейдите по ссылке:

http://мой_сайт/index.php?route=account/order/info&order_id=18

После подтверждения оплаты, чтобы скачать товар, щелкните:

http://мой_сайт/index.php?route=account/download

 

Но в загрузках всё та же картина: отсутствие ссылки 

 

Есть ли ещё идеи?

 

Спасибо!

Надіслати
Поділитися на інших сайтах


Судя по ...

 

 

... У  вас какой-то модуль стоит, который "должен" отправлять? Или вы всё делаете средствами функционала opencart?

 

Так там нету "отправки"

Если "модуль", то мы можем телепатировать сколько угодно, почему он глючит, не зная его

 

Нет, специального модуля нет.. (Всё только средствами Опенкарт), действительно отправлять не должен и не отправляет, а только указывает ссылку на страницу с загрузками.... Но на этой странице самих ссылок на купленные файлы по какой-то причине нет (пока неясно по какой причине.. ) 

Надіслати
Поділитися на інших сайтах


Небольшое продвижение: обнаружилось ограничение в настройках EASY UPLOAD на число скачиваний (по-умолчанию стояло на нуле), но после добавления выплзли ужасные строки )

--

Notice: Error: You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near 'ASC DESC LIMIT 0,15' at line 1

Error No: 1064
SELECT o.order_id, o.date_added, od.order_download_id, od.name, od.filename, od.remaining FROM oc_order_download od LEFT JOIN `oc_order` o ON (od.order_id = o.order_id) WHERE o.customer_id = '1' AND o.order_status_id > '0' AND o.order_status_id = '5' AND od.remaining > 0 ORDER BY ASC DESC LIMIT 0,15 in /home/tehnolux/public_html/audio-for-media.ru/system/database/mysql.php on line 50

--

 

Что это может значить? )))

 

Спасибо!

Надіслати
Поділитися на інших сайтах


Т.е. как я понял, важно, чтобы статусы в обоих настройках были одинаковые... Да, так и есть.. В обоих стоит "Сделка завершена". Так же пробовал в обоих местах (настройке опций магазина и модуля оплаты) менять на "Доставлено", но то же самое... В личном кабинете загрузок так и не появляется...

А чего им появиться, если вы настройки крутите, а заказ неизвестно с каким статусом лежит. У существующего заказа теперь зайдите в просмотр (не редактирование) и на вкладке истории заказа измените статус на тот, с которым он считается завершённым (оплаченным). При совпадении со статусом из настроек магазина файлы доступны покупателю.
Надіслати
Поділитися на інших сайтах


Всем участникам обсуждения огромная благодарность!

 

Вопрос решился после удаления вкмода easy uploader

 

С ним удобно добавлять файлы, но вот почему-то отдачу загрузок он не любит..

 

Версия движка: ocStore  1.5.5.1.2

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.